Departments

Welcome to the Town of Harrison’s Departments page. Here you’ll find information about the various departments that provide services to residents, businesses, and visitors. From public safety to permitting, our staff is here to support the community and keep things running smoothly.

If you’re not sure which department to contact, feel free to reach out to the Town Office—we’re happy to point you in the right direction.

Clerk's Office
Handles vital records, licensing, elections, and other town administrative services.


General Assistance
Provides temporary financial assistance and support for qualifying residents in need.


Assessor
Manages property valuation, exemptions, and assessment records for tax purposes.


Code Enforcement
Oversees building permits, land use regulations, shoreland zoning, and related inspections.


Parks & Recreation
Offers seasonal programs, events, and recreational opportunities for all ages.


Public Safety
Coordinates emergency services and supports fire and rescue operations.


Public Works
Maintains town roads, infrastructure, winter plowing, and seasonal maintenance projects.


Transfer Station
Provides waste disposal, recycling, and related services to residents.


Staff Directory
A list of department contacts, phone numbers, and emails.

Town of Harrison, PO Box 300, 20 Front Street, Harrison, ME 04040